Désirée Klingler serves as Assistant Professor of Administrative Law at the University of St. Gallen's Law School with specialized focus on Sustainable and Smart City Governance, affiliated with the Institute for European Law (ILE-HSG).
Her research examines legal and economic implications of public sector regulation emphasizing sustainability, innovation, and data analysis. She teaches International Trade Law, European Public Procurement Law, and Climate Law & Policy, bridging theoretical frameworks with practical governance challenges in smart city development.
Prof. Klingler acts as co-editor of the European Procurement & Public Private Partnership Law Review and provides advisory services to the United Nations Economic Commission for Europe (UNECE) regarding Sustainable Development Goals implementation. She contributes to European Commission reports as a TED Ambassador and participates in policy-shaping initiatives through these high-level appointments.
Prior to her academic appointment, she practiced law in New York, served as court clerk at the Federal Administrative Court, taught Competition Law and Economics at the University of Hamburg, and conducted research at Yale Law School, U.C. Berkeley Haas Business School, and Copenhagen Business School.
